A member asked:

My brother was bitten by a dog in mexico, until he get the rabbies vaccine what precautions he should take to not infect the family members?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Don't bite: Rabies is a virus that is found in the saliva of infected animals. I don't think and haven't seen it be transmitted from a person to another. He should have gotten the rabies immunoglobulin and vaccine as soon as possible if there was a concern about rabies. If the dog is able to be found it should be evaluated by a veterinarian or euthanized to be studied. I hope your brother is doing well.
